body, html, div, blockquote, img, label,  h1, h2, h3, h4, h5, h6, pre, dl, dt, dd, form, a, fieldset, input, th, td
{margin: 0; padding: 0;  outline: none; font-family:Arial;}

body	{
			margin:10px 0 0 0;
			background: url(../../images/background.jpg) repeat-x top left;
			background-color:#6d2324;
			}
.png_file
{ 
	behavior:url(../JS/iepngfix.htc);
	
}						
.Header_strip_main{				
			font-family:arial;
			font-size: 14pt;
			color: #1B276F;
			font-weight: bold;
			text-align: left;
			}
				
.header_strip {
			background:url(../../images/bg_menu.jpg) repeat-x;
			height:34px;
			font-family:arial;
			font-size:11pt;
			font-weight:bold;
			color:#ffffff;
			text-align:left;
			vertical-align:middle;
			padding:0 0 0 15px;
			
			
			
			
}

.header_strip_admin {
			background:#3fa1ce;
			height:23px;
			font-family:arial;
			font-size:13pt;
			font-weight:bold;
			color:#ffffff;
			text-align:right;
			vertical-align:middle;
			padding-right:15px;
						
			
}
				
.toplink		{
				font-family:arial;
				font-weight: normal;
				font-size:9pt;
				color:#6d2324;
				/*text-align: right;*/
				line-height:19px;
				}
.toplink a:link		{	
			text-decoration:underline;
			color:#6d2324;
			}
.toplink a:activated	{	
			text-decoration:underline;
			color:#6d2324;
			}
.toplink a:visited	{	
			text-decoration:underline;
			color:#6d2324;
			}
.toplink a:hover	{	
			text-decoration:none;
			color:#0096db;
				
				}
				
.toplink2		{
				font-family:arial;
				font-weight: normal;
				font-size:9pt;
				color:#000000;
				text-align:left;
				line-height:19px;
				}
				
.toplink2 a:link		{	
			text-decoration:underline;
			color:#000000;
			}
.toplink2 a:activated	{	
			text-decoration:underline;
			color:#000000;
			}
.toplink2 a:visited	{	
			text-decoration:underline;
			color:#000000;
			}
.toplink2 a:hover	{	
			text-decoration:none;
			color:#0096db;
				
				}
				
				
.ReadMore		{
				font-family:arial;
				font-weight: normal;
				font-size:9pt;
				color:#6d2324;
				/*text-align: right;*/
				line-height:19px;
				}
.ReadMore a:link		
{
	text-decoration:none;	
			color:#6d2324;
			}
.ReadMore a:activated	
{
	text-decoration:none;	
			color:#6d2324;
			}
.ReadMore a:visited	
{
			text-decoration:none;	
			color:#6d2324;
			}
.ReadMore a:hover	{	
			text-decoration:none;
			color:#6e2324;
				
				}

				
				

				

.GridText
{
	font-family: Verdana;
	font-size: 8pt;
	font-weight: normal;
	line-height: 20px;
	text-align: left;
	color: #000000;
	vertical-align: top;
	border: solid 1px #6F8E4A;
	margin: 10px 0 0 0;
}

.GridHead
{
	background-color: #3FA1CE;
	font-family: Arial;
	font-weight: bold;
	height: 22px;
	color: #ffffff;
	padding: 0px 0 0px 5px;
}


.GridHead a:link
{
	color: #ffffff;
	text-decoration: none;
}
.GridHead a:activated
{
	color: #ffffff;
	text-decoration: none;
}
.GridHead a:visited
{
	color: #ffffff;
	text-decoration: none;
}
.GridHead a:hover
{
	color: #ffffff;
	text-decoration: none;
}

.GridRow a:link
{
	color: #003066;
	text-decoration: none;
}
.GridRow a:activated
{
	color: #003066;
	text-decoration: none;
}
.GridRow a:visited
{
	color: #003066;
	text-decoration: none;
}
.GridRow a:hover
{
	color: #ff0000;
	text-decoration: underline;
}


.GridRow
{
	background-color: #E2ECF8;
	padding: 0 0 0 5px;
}
.GridAlternate
{
	background-color: #ffffff;
	padding: 0 0 0 5px;
}
.GridAlternate a:link
{
	color: #003066;
	text-decoration: none;
}
.GridAlternate a:activated
{
	color: #003066;
	text-decoration: none;
}
.GridAlternate a:visited
{
	color: #003066;
	text-decoration: none;
}
.GridAlternate a:hover
{
	color: #ff0000;
	text-decoration: underline;
}



.GridText .GridFooter
{
	background-color: #b65518;
	padding: 0 0 0 5px;
	color:#ffffff;
}
.GridEditedRow
{
	background-color: #3CB8BD;
	font-family: Arial;
	font-weight: bold;
	height: 22px;
	color: #ffffff;
	padding: 0px 0 0px 5px;
}
.GridTexBox
{
	text-align:right;
	padding:0 0 0 30px;
	
}

.PaginationText
{
	font-family: Verdana;
	font-size: 8pt;
	font-weight: normal;
	text-align: left;
	vertical-align: middle;
	color: #000000;
}

INPUT.FileUpload
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 10px;
	height: 18px;
	font-weight: normal;
	vertical-align: middle;
	color:inherit;
	content:inherit;
/*	  : #323F51;*/
	border: none;
	width: 0px;
/*	size:1;*/
	border-style: ridge;
border-width: 0; 
background-color: #C1C9A9;
position: relative;
    text-align: right;    
    filter:alpha(opacity: 0);
   opacity: 0;
}



.maindiv
			{width:900px;}		


.left_panel	{position:relative;
			margin:-52px 0 0 12px;
			z-index:2;
			
			}
			

.leftpannelinner
			{
			width:240px;	
			position:relative;
			z-index:30000;
			margin:-230px 0 0 30px;
			
				}


.top_link1
			{font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align:left;
				color: #000000;}
			
.top_link1 a:link
{
color: #000000;
text-decoration:none;
}	
.top_link1 a:hover
{
color: #000000;
text-decoration:none;
}	

.top_link02
			{font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align:left;
				color: #625f5e;}
			

.body_text
			{font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align:justify;
				color: #000000;
				padding:0px 17px 0 10px;}
				
				
.body_text_02
			{font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align:  justify;
				color: #000000;
				padding:0px 10px 10px 10px;
				}
.body_text_02 a:link
{
	color: #000000;
	text-decoration: none;
	cursor:pointer;
}
.body_text_02 a:activated
{
	color: #000000;
	text-decoration: none;
	cursor:pointer;
}
.body_text_02 a:visited
{
	color: #000000;
	text-decoration: none;
	cursor:pointer;
}
.body_text_02 a:hover
{
	color: #000000;
	text-decoration:underline;
	cursor:pointer;
}				
				
				

.body_text_cust
			{	font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align: left;
				color: #625f5e;
				padding:0px 0px 0 0px;}
			
			
h2 {
	padding:11px 0 10px 10px;
	text-align:left;
	font-family:verdana;
	font-size:15pt;
	font-weight:normal;
	color: #6e2324;} 			


h3 {
	padding:0 0 0 10px;
	text-align:left;
	font-family:Verdana;
	font-size:19px;
	font-weight: normal;
	color: #6e2324 ;
}
h6 {
	padding:0px 0 10px 0px;
	text-align:left;
	font-family:Verdana;
	font-size:13px;
	font-weight: bold;
	color: #000000;
}		

h4 {
	padding:0px 0 0 0px;
	text-align:left;
	font-family:Verdana;
	font-size:13px;
	font-weight: bold;
	color: #1B7EAE;
}		

h5 {
	padding:0 0 5px 10px;
	text-align:left;
	font-family:Verdana;
	font-size:16px;
	font-weight: bold;
	color: #000000;
	text-decoration:none;
	}
.add {
	
	text-align:left;
	font-family:Verdana;
	font-size:18px;
	font-weight: normal;
	color: #000000;
	text-decoration:none;
	}




.left_top	{background:  url(../../images/left_top.jpg) no-repeat;
			width:300px;
			height:237px;}
			

.testimonial_text
			{
				font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align: left;
				color: #625f5e;
				padding:30px 19px 0 0px;}
			
			
.director
			{
				font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align: center;
				color: #000000;
				padding-top:10px;}			
			
.strip_text
			{
				font-family:Verdana;
				font-size:22px;
				font-weight: normal;
				text-align: right;
				color: #ffffff;
				padding-top:5px;}		
			
			
.footer_text
			{
				text-align: center;
				font-family:Arial;
				font-size:11px;
				font-weight:normal;
				line-height:18px;
				color: #ffffff; }
.footer_text a:link	{
				color:#ffffff;
				text-decoration: none;
			}

.footer_text a:visited{
				color:#ffffff;
				text-decoration: none;
			}


.footer_text a:hover	{
			color:#f2b30c;
			text-decoration: underline;
			}
			
			
.login_bg	{
            background:url(../../images/login_repet.jpg) repeat-y top left;

			}
			
.login_text
			{
				font-family:arial;
				font-size:12px;
				font-weight: normal;
				text-align: center;
				color: #544d4a;
				padding:9px 0 0 12px;
				
			}		
			
			
.forget_password
			{
				font-family:arial;
				font-size:11px;
				font-weight: normal;
				text-align: left;
				color: #544d4a;	
			}		
			
.forget_password a:link	{
				color:#000000;
				text-decoration: none;
			}
			
.forget_password a:visited {	
				color:#000000;
				text-decoration: none;}		

.forget_password a:hover	{
			color:#894185;
			text-decoration: underline;
			}
.scroll
			{
				font-family:Arial;
				font-size:12px;
				font-weight: normal;
				text-align: left;
				color:#625f5e ;	
				padding:0 0 0 7px;
			}		
.scroll a:link
{
	color: #625f5e;
	text-decoration: none;
	cursor:pointer;
}
.scroll a:activated
{
	color: #625f5e;
	text-decoration: none;
	cursor:pointer;
}
.scroll a:visited
{
	color: #625f5e;
	text-decoration: none;
	cursor:pointer;
}
.scroll a:hover
{
	color: #6d2324;
	text-decoration:underline;
	cursor:pointer;
}


.breadcrumb		
			{
			
			font-family:verdana;
			font-weight:normal;
			font-size:18px;
			color: #000000;
			
			/*text-align:left;*/
			text-align:left;
			text-decoration:none;
			}
				
.breadcrumb a:link		{	
			/*text-decoration:underline;*/
			color: #000000;
			text-decoration:none;
			}
.breadcrumb a:activated	{	
			/*text-decoration:underline;*/
			color: #000000;
			text-decoration:none;
			}
.breadcrumb a:visited	{	
			/*text-decoration:underline;*/
			color: #000000;
			text-decoration:none;
			}
.breadcrumb a:hover	{	
			text-decoration:none;
			color:#1B7EAE;
				
				}


.textlink		
			{
			font-family:Verdana;
			font-size:9pt;
			color: #625f5e;
			text-align:left;
			text-decoration:underline;
			}

.textlink a:link
{	
	text-decoration:underline;
	color: #625f5e;
}				
.textlink a:hover
{	
	text-decoration:none;
	color: #1B7EAE;
}


.textlink a:visited	
{	
	text-decoration:underline;
	color: #625f5e;
}
.photo-gallery
{
	/*background: url(../../Images/bg-photo-gallery.jpg) repeat-x;*/
	background-color:#3597C6;
}
.borderit img
{
	border: solid 1px #ffffff;
}

.borderit:hover img
{
	border: 1px solid #5C7A32;
}

.img_cust
{
	/*background-image:url(../../images/map.jpg);*/
	width:100px; 
	height:100px;
}
.newsdate
{
	font-family:Arial;
	font-size:12px;
	font-weight: bold;
	text-align: left;
	color:#000000 ;	
	padding:0 0 0 7px;
}
.bo
{
	border:solid 1px red;
}

.multiple
			{
				font-family:Arial;
				font-size:12px;
				font-weight: bold;
				text-align: left;
				color:#000000 ;	
				padding:0 0 0 7px;
			}		
.multiple a:link
{
	color: #000000;
	text-decoration: none;
	cursor:pointer;
}
.multiple a:activated
{
	color: #000000;
	text-decoration: none;
	cursor:pointer;
}
.multiple a:visited
{
	color: #000000;
	text-decoration: none;
	cursor:pointer;
}
.multiple a:hover
{
	color: #6d2324;
	text-decoration:underline;
	cursor:pointer;
}
.image
{
	border:solid 3px #D8D7D3;
	float:left;
	margin:0 10px 0 0;
}
.black
{
	color:Black;
	font-weight:bold;
	font-family:Arial;
	font-size:12px;
}

.textbox
		{font-family:verdana;
		font-size:9pt;
		font-weight:normal;
		text-align: left;
		color:#000000;
		background:url(../../images/bg-text.jpg) no-repeat;
		height:27px;
		border:none;
		width:250px;
		padding:7px 0 5px 10px;
		
	}
.textaria		{ 	font-family:verdana;
					font-size:9pt;
					font-weight:normal;
					text-align: left;
					color:#000000;
					height:50px;
					border:0px;
					width:220px;
					padding:7px 0 5px 10px;
				}
				
.textaria2		{ 	font-family:verdana;
					font-size:9pt;
					font-weight:normal;
					text-align: left;
					color:#000000;
					height:40px;
					border:0px;
					width:220px;
					padding:7px 0 5px 10px;
				}	
				
.bgbigtextbox	{background:url(../../images/bg-bigtexaria.jpg) repeat-y;}	
/* New Css Date 18-12-09*/
.toppunchline{font-family:verdana; font-size:13px; vertical-align:bottom; font-weight:bold;text-align: left;color:#000000;border:0px;}	

/* New Css Date 18-12-09 End*/